Pixverse v6 Text-to-Video API Documentation
Overview
Pixverse v6 provides advanced text-to-video generation, supporting dynamic camera changes and multiple resolutions up to 1080p.Authentication
All API requests require authentication using your API key. Include it in the Authorization header:Submit Text-to-Video Request
Base URL
Endpoint
Request Format
Request Parameters
| Parameter | Type | Required | Description | Default |
|---|---|---|---|---|
prompt | string | Yes | Primary text prompt describing the video (up to 5000 chars). | "" |
duration | integer | Yes | Video length in seconds. 1-15s. | 5 |
aspect_ratio | enum | Yes | Video aspect ratio (16:9, 9:16, 1:1, 4:3, 3:4). | “16:9” |
quality | enum | Yes | Video resolution (360p, 540p, 720p, 1080p). | “540p” |
generate_audio_switch | boolean | No | Automatically generate BGM and sound effects. | false |
generate_multi_clip_switch | boolean | No | Enable dynamic camera changes and transitions. | false |
seed | integer | No | Set a specific seed for reproducible results (0-2147483647). | null |
Response
Check Request Status
Endpoint
Response
Request Status Values
| Status | Description | |||
|---|---|---|---|---|
queued | Request is waiting in the queue | \n | processing | Video is currently being generated |
success | Video generation completed | \n | failed | Generation failed (check logs for details) |
cancelled | Request was manually cancelled |